U.S. Investigates Potential Iranian Involvement in Cyberattack on Minnesota Water Infrastructure
Just the facts
United States federal agencies launched an inquiry into a cyber intrusion affecting municipal water facilities in Minnesota. Investigators are examining digital evidence to determine if actors linked to Iran carried out the network breach. Industrial control systems in public utilities are subject to federal cybersecurity monitoring standards. The Department of Homeland Security and the FBI routinely assess infrastructure vulnerabilities following cyber threats.
